Cyber Capability Development Centre (CCDC) Private Cloud Design

Abstract

In order to support short- and long-term cyber science and technology (S and T) delivery, Defence Research and Development Canada (DRDC) requires an agile and effective infrastructure for cyber research, experimentation, testing and evaluation, demonstration, and training. This capability is referred to as the Cyber Capability Development Centre (CCDC). The design of the CCDCs research lab infrastructure needs to be based on the formalized requirements, which are a collection of approximately 120 S and T-related CCDC requirements that were derived from questionnaires and subsequent interviews with Cyber R and D staff.
